How long is the warranty coverage?
The Fountainhead Group, Inc. (FGI) warrants to the original product purchaser, that each product will be free from defects in material and workmanship, under normal use and conditions, for a period of one (1) year from the date of purchase. FGI makes no other express warranties, and all implied warranties, including fitness and merchantability, are limited to one (1) year from the date of purchase. FGI reserves the right to require the return of the defective product with the proof of purchase to establish a claim under this warranty.

What does my warranty cover?
The Fountainhead Group, Inc. (FGI) warrants to the original product purchaser, that each product will be free from defects in material and workmanship, under normal use and conditions.
This limited warranty does not cover any damage or defect resulting from transportation, storage, maintenance, improper use, negligence, accident, normal wear, alterations, or operation or any other activity or action which is not in accordance with the instruction manual. Any parts that are deemed wearable parts are not part of the limited warranty.

How do I clean the nozzle?
If a nozzle clogs, remove and disassemble the nozzle assembly. Clean the openings of any obstructions or residue. Do not use sharp tools that could scratch or damage the nozzles as spray pattern could be affected. Do not hit nozzle against surfaces to unclog.

Which sprayers can be used to stain a wooden fence or deck?
All of our stainless steel, poly tank and backpacks sprayers would work with a clear water-based sealer, or semi viscous material. Solid stains with overly thick viscosity would be a challenge. If you require further information please call our Customer Service team at 800-311-9903.
